Rio Medina, TX Local Guide

Largest Available Rio Medina and Nearby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in Rio Medina, TX is found at Redbird Ridge Apartments in the Far West Side neighborhood and is 602 square feet priced from $1,095. Westpointe Oaks Apartments has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 565 square feet and currently listed start at $975.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Rio Medina:

Cheapest Available Rio Medina and Nearby Studio Apartments

As of September 09,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Rio Medina, TX is the Studio Model starting from $700 at Pawel Village in the Far West Side neighborhood. The second most affordable Rio Medina Studio is the E1 Model at Esperanza starting at $899 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Rio Medina is currently $960.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in Rio Medina:

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Rio Medina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Rio Medina with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Rio Medina is at Pawel Village listed at $700.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Rio Medina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Rio Medina is $960.

What is the largest available Studio Rio Medina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Rio Medina is a 602 square feet unit starting from $1,095 at Redbird Ridge Apartments.

What is the average size for Rio Medina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Rio Medina is currently 523 sq ft.
